Registered Respiratory Care Practitioner
Saint Peters
The Registered Respiratory Care Practitioner will:
- Provide all aspects of therapeutic and diagnostic respiratory
care based on established American Association of Respiratory Care
Standards and Saint Peters University Hospital Policies and
Procedures. Demonstrates competency in all procedures within the
scope of practice, as appropriate to the ages of the patients
served; the ability to obtain information and interpret information
in terms of the patients needs; a knowledge of growth and
development and an understanding of the range of treatment needed
by these patients.
- Administer oxygen therapy according to policy and
procedure.
- Perform diagnostic tests according to policy and procedure as
appropriate to the ages of the patient's growth and development
through the life cycle factors (Neonates, Pediatrics, Adolescents,
Adult, and Geriatrics).
- Initiate and maintain mechanical ventilation according to
policy and procedure as appropriate to the ages of the patient's
growth and development through the life cycle factors (Neonates,
Pediatrics, Adolescents, Adult, and Geriatrics).
- Maintain, evaluate and operate respiratory care equipment.
- Respond to emergency situations in Hospital as appropriate to
the ages of the patient's growth and development through the life
cycle factors (Neonates, Pediatrics, Adolescents, Adult, and
Geriatrics).
- Attend and participate in education and Department
meetings.

Requirements:
- Graduate of an AMA-approved one (1) year Program in Respiratory
Therapy.
- Licensed by the State of New Jersey Board of Respiratory Care
as a Respiratory Care Practitioner and Registered Respiratory
Therapist (RRT) by the National Board for Respiratory Care
(NBRC).
- Demonstrated competency in all procedures within scope of
practice, as appropriate to the ages of the patients served; the
ability to obtain information and interpret information in terms of
the patient's needs; a knowledge of growth and development and an
understanding of the range of treatment needed by these
patients.
- Demonstrated competency in the care and treatment of the
following age groups: Infant, Pediatric, Adolescent, Adult and
Geriatric.
- BLS Certification required, as approved by the American Heart
Association.
- Pediatric Advance Life Support (PALS) obtained within 30 days
of start date.
- Registered Respiratory Care Practitioners trained and assigned
to the Neonatal Intensive Care Unit on a regular basis is required
to obtain the Neonatal Resuscitation Program (NRP)
certification.
